If this stat is legit then it shows that our 1 season in the Prem had a squad cost of almost 80 mio. On top of that I guess you can add the general running of the club, academy and the 5 million we spent on improving the stadium facilities. And then there is the transfer deficit in the two years leading to promotion. You get a lot of people asking where the 100 million pay off has gone and here is the answer. https://twitter.com/search?f=tweets&q=%23Boro&src=typd

 

We get roughly 75 million in parachute payments after relegation and that has to be spend wisely. Luckily we somehow managed to balance income and outcome on transfer fees last season despite buying players for almost 50 million if the rumoured numbers are correct, and this summer we look like coming out with a pretty big transfer income thanks mainly to Gibson and Traore.

 

We will still have a rather big wage budget and general costs compared to Championship standard so the parachute money falls in a dry spot and our sensible transfer business this summer should help the club to a sound financial footing in the coming years even if promotion isn't achieved.
